Final Dash for Cash

The fourth and final Dash for Cash for 2021, again sponsored by Safeway Security Screens, was held under grey but fine skies on Saturday 28th August. 22 teams of men had registered for this event, but unfortunately only 21 teams turned up, which meant a frantic search for players to make up a balancing team. This search was ultimately successful and a team was cobbled together of injured and part-time bowlers, including one lady, taking to the greens slightly later than planned.

Four matches of 11 ends were played, with two matches in the morning and two in the afternoon separated by the customary, but nevertheless welcome, soup-and-a-roll lunch. Thanks to the ladies who provided the lunch and also the morning tea prior to play. In total about eight ladies volunteered to help during the day and their contribution was very much appreciated.

After the morning rounds only four teams had won both matches, and by the end of the third match only two teams remained undefeated, with one of these falling at the final hurdle. While there were 39 visiting bowlers of the 88 competing, Sorrento players dominated the results.
